The Impact of Temperature ControlFluctuating temperatures are the ultimate enemy of cosmetic face paints. Storing your kit in a damp basement, a hot garage, or the trunk of a car will cause the paints to break down rapidly. Extreme heat melts the binding agents in the cakes, turning vibrant pigments into a gooey, unusable mess. Conversely, freezing temperatures can cause the paint to crack, split, and lose its smooth consistency. To preserve your investment, find a dedicated climate-controlled space inside your living quarters. A dark bedroom closet or a temperature-stable pantry keeps the paints at an optimal room temperature, ensuring the formulas remain smooth and ready for creating perfect leopard spots or puppy noses.
Moisture Management and Drying ProceduresMoisture is the primary catalyst for bacteria and mold growth in cosmetic products. Packing away wet face paint cakes creates a breeding ground for microorganisms, which poses a health risk to the children and volunteers at your next event. After a busy day of transforming faces into lions and tigers, you must allow your palette to air-dry completely. Leave the lids off your paint containers in a clean, dust-free room for several hours until the surface feels bone-dry to the touch. Once all residual moisture from your brushes and sponges has evaporated, seal the containers tightly to lock out ambient humidity.
Organizing Brushes, Sponges, and StencilsA well-organized kit saves time and protects expensive application tools from damage. Animal lovers frequently opt for synthetic taklon paintbrushes, which mimic the soft performance of natural animal hair without using animal products. To keep these synthetic bristles straight and split-free, store them horizontally in a breathable brush roll or vertically in a drying rack with the tips pointing downward. Sponges should be washed thoroughly with a gentle, fragrance-free soap, allowed to air dry completely, and then stored in a breathable mesh bag. Keep your reusable plastic animal stencils flat in a binder with plastic sleeves to prevent bending or creasing.
Sanitization Protocols Before Long-Term StorageProper hygiene is vital to extending the lifespan of your face painting gear. Before sealing your kit for an extended period, mist the surface of your dry paint cakes with a cosmetic-grade sanitizer spray containing seventy percent isopropyl alcohol. Avoid flooding the cakes; a light, even mist is all that is required to eliminate surface bacteria without degrading the pigment. Wipe down the exterior plastic cases with sanitizing wipes to remove any colorful smudges or fingerprints. This quick sanitization routine ensures that your gear remains pristine, fresh, and ready for immediate deployment at the next community gathering.
Monitoring Expiration Dates and Product IntegrityEven under perfect conditions, face paints do not last forever. Most professional water-based paints feature a Period After Opening symbol on the label, typically indicating a lifespan of twelve to eighteen months after the seal is broken. Use a permanent marker to write the opening date directly on the bottom of each container. Periodically inspect your stored inventory for any changes in scent, texture, or appearance. If a paint cake develops a strange odor, hardens into an unworkable block, or shows any signs of discoloration, discard it immediately.
